Define Your Business Goals and Marketing Needs
Clearly outline your primary business objectives. Are you looking to boost brand awareness, generate leads, or enhance customer engagement? Use the SMART criteria—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ound—to articulate these goals effectively. Instead of a vague aim like 'increase sales,' specify a target such as 'achieve a 20% increase in sales within the next quarter through focused digital campaigns.' This clarity streamlines discussions with potential digital marketing ads agencies and aids in assessing their expertise in meeting your specific needs.

Evaluate Pricing Models and Budget Fit
When evaluating a digital marketing ads agency, it is crucial to examine its pricing structures. Common pricing structures include:
- Hourly Rates: Charges based on time spent on your project, typically ranging from $50 to $300 per hour, depending on the agency's expertise and location.
- Retainer Fees: A fixed monthly fee for ongoing services, ranging from $1,500 to $30,000, which facilitates predictable budgeting.
- Project-Based Pricing: A set fee for specific projects or campaigns, varying widely from $1,000 to $100,000 based on complexity and scope.
- Performance-Based Pricing: Fees linked to results achieved, such as lead generation or sales conversions, ensuring clients pay only for successful outcomes.
It's vital to ensure that the agency's pricing aligns with your budget and that you fully understand the services included in their fees. Requesting a detailed breakdown of costs can clarify expectations and prevent surprises. Establish a Collaborative Partnership with Your Agency
Cultivating a successful partnership with your digital marketing ads agency requires a strategic approach. Here are key strategies to implement:
- Set Clear Expectations: Start discussions about your objectives, timelines, and preferred communication methods from the outset. This clarity lays the groundwork for a productive relationship.
- Regular Check-Ins: Establish a routine for meetings to evaluate progress, address challenges, and adjust strategies as needed. Consistent communication keeps both parties aligned and responsive to changes.
- Feedback Loop: Create an environment that encourages constructive feedback. This practice refines strategies and enhances outcomes over time.
A collaborative approach not only boosts the effectiveness of your campaigns with a digital marketing ads agency but also nurtures a positive working relationship.
